Overview of ICF Building Materials

Component Description Benefits
Insulated Forms Hollow foam blocks that stack and interlock Superior insulation and structural support
Rebar Steel reinforcement bars placed inside forms before concrete pour Increased strength and stability
Concrete High-strength mix poured into forms to create solid concrete walls Durability and energy efficiency

ICF building materials consist of three main components: insulated foam forms, steel reinforcement bars (rebar), and concrete.

The forms, made of expanded polystyrene (EPS) foam, stack and interlock like Lego blocks to create the shape of your walls.

Rebar is then placed inside the forms to provide additional strength.

Finally, concrete is poured into the forms, creating a solid, monolithic structure with exceptional insulation properties.

Essential ICF Accessories for Springfield Construction

In addition to the core ICF components, several accessories are crucial for successful projects in Springfield:

Accessory Purpose
Bracing Systems Provide temporary support during construction
Waterproofing Protect against moisture intrusion in Springfield’s humid climate
Fasteners Secure forms and attach finish materials to ICF walls
  • Bracing Systems: These temporary supports hold the ICF forms in place during the concrete pour and initial curing process. Proper bracing is essential to ensure straight, plumb walls.
  • Waterproofing Membranes: Springfield’s humid climate makes moisture control a top priority. Waterproofing membranes applied to the exterior of ICF walls prevent water intrusion and protect your investment.
  • Specialty Fasteners: ICF-specific fasteners are designed to secure forms together and attach finish materials like drywall and siding to the concrete walls without compromising the insulation layer.

Moisture Control with ICF Building Materials

Springfield’s climate presents unique challenges when it comes to moisture control in construction.

ICF building materials offer inherent advantages in managing moisture effectively:

Strategy Benefit Additional Advantage
Continuous Insulation Minimizes condensation risk by keeping interior surfaces warm Enhances energy efficiency
Capillary Break EPS foam layer prevents moisture wicking from foundation to walls Reduces mold growth potential
Waterproofing Membranes Added protection against water intrusion from exterior sources Extends building lifespan

By selecting moisture-resistant ICF materials and following best practices for waterproofing, you can ensure a dry, comfortable, and healthy indoor environment for your Springfield home or business.

Optimizing Energy Efficiency with ICF

ICF construction offers unmatched energy efficiency benefits for Springfield’s climate.

The continuous insulation provided by the EPS foam forms creates a tight building envelope, minimizing air leaks and thermal bridging.

This results in more consistent indoor temperatures and reduced load on HVAC systems.

To maximize energy savings, consider these tips:

  1. Opt for thicker EPS foam forms (2.5″ or greater) for higher R-values
  2. Ensure proper installation of forms and sealing of joints to prevent air leaks
  3. Combine ICF walls with energy-efficient windows, doors, and roofing materials

Compared to traditional wood-frame construction, ICF homes in Springfield can save homeowners up to 50% on their annual energy bills – a significant long-term benefit.
